Google designed its passkeys to work with a variety of devices, so you can use them on iPhones, Macs and Windows computers as well as Google’s own Android phones.

Users won’t ever see them directly instead, an online service like Gmail will use them to communicate directly with a trusted device such as your phone or computer to log you in.Īll you’ll have to do is verify your identity on the device using a PIN unlock code, biometrics such as your fingerprint or a face scan or a more sophisticated physical security dongle.
